While it's true that anyone living in a property for 30 days or more gains certain tenant protections, this doesn't provide them ownership rights. The individual is considered a month-to-month tenant under California law. They cannot be removed without a formal eviction process. . California squatter rights state that you must provide a squatter with an official notice to vacate to start the eviction process, which means you must go through the legal channels before removing a squatter. . Property owners have the right to take legal action to evict or remove squatters from any vacant building or land that they own. . If they don’t leave within 3 days, file for eviction through the courts. Work with law enforcement to remove the squatters after receiving a writ of possession. In California, as in almost all other states, removing a squatter necessitates the full eviction process. Treating the squatter like any other tenant ensures that any adverse possession claim they file is invalid. . It's important that you know how to evict a squatter in California the right way. Find out what to do by checking out this guide. . A squatter must occupy a property openly and continuously for at least 5 years to claim adverse possession in California. Yes, squatters who occupy a property for 30 days or more may establish tenancy rights, requiring a formal eviction process. .
